8 DE ENERO DE 1969

Filmaciones de “Get Back” en Twickenham Studios. Hoy ensayaron los siguientes temas: "I Me Mine", "Honey, Hush", "Stand By Me", "Hare Krishna Mantra", "Well If You're Ready", "Two Of Us", "You Got Me Going", "Twist And Shout", "Don't Let Me Down", "I've Got A Feeling", "St Louis Blues", "One After 909", "Too Bad About Sorrows", "Just Fun", "She Said She Said", "All Things Must Pass", "All Along the Watchtower", "Mean Mr. Mustard", "Fools Like Me", "You Win Again", "She Came In THrough the Bathroom Window", "Maxwell's Silver Hammer", "How Do You Think I Feel", "Ballad of Bonnie and Clyde", "Hello Muddah Hello Faddah", "F.B.I.", "I'm Going To Knock Him Down Dead", "Oh! Darling", "Let It Be", "Domino", "The Long And Winding Road", "Adagio For Strings", "Tell All the Folks Back Home", "True Love", "Shout!", "Sweet Little Sixteen", "Malanguena", "Almost Grown", "What Am I Living For?", "Rock and Roll Music" y "To Kingdom Come". El principal acontecimiento de este día fue una discusión entre John y George porque John se desinteresó por completo en una canción escrita por George.
